By Osmar Toc For the World Day against Child Labour — June 12th — they develop a recreational activity with minors in Quetzaltenango. The activity was organized by the Municipal Office of Education and the Office of Children, Adolescents and Youth of Quetzaltenango, with the support of the administration of the La Democracia Market.
